Now for boxes... I think I am going to get a custom one built... should I go ported or sealed and what is the advantage if I was running a 15w6? Thanks!
Reply
Old Jan 19, 2004 | 05:49 PM
  #59  
Slick666's Avatar
Member
Posts like a V-Tak
 
Joined: Aug 2003
Posts: 65
Likes: 0
From: Upstate NY
Slick666 is on a distinguished road
Default

I think you would do good to keep it simple and go with a sealed box. It provides good sound quality and are simple and inexpensive to make. I would sugest you NOT get a bandpass box. Even though they can make a sub PUOND they don't provide as 'good' sound quality. I've found most to be just loud. Also it is harder to hear the sub start to distort if you are running them hard. Almost all the kids that came back to me with blown subs either had bandpass or didn't understand the first thing about speakers.
